Four Local Teams Ranked in First Softball State Poll
Austintown Fitch tops Division I, Boardman and Lakeview also ranked
Apr. 14, 2026 at 1:50am
Got story updates? Submit your updates here. ›
The early state softball rankings highlight the competitive spirit and talent of local high school programs in the Youngstown area.Youngstown TodayThe Ohio High School Softball Coaches Association released the first coaches poll for the 2026 season, with four Valley teams earning rankings. Austintown Fitch was voted the top-ranked team in Division I, while Boardman earned fourth in Division III and Lakeview is ranked third in Division IV. Beaver Local also earned a tie for eighth in Division IV.

The details
In the Division I poll, Austintown Fitch earned 9 first-place votes and 90 total points to claim the top spot. In Division III, Boardman earned 51 total points for the fourth ranking. Lakeview is ranked third in Division IV with 76 total points, and Beaver Local tied for eighth in that division with 24 points.
- The Ohio High School Softball Coaches Association released the first coaches poll for the 2026 season on Monday, April 14, 2026.
